dc.description.abstractRoentgen computed microtomography (micro-CT) allows visualizing internal structure of measured objects determined by density differences. Micro-CT measurements enable obtaining of many parallel 2D cross sections, which allows to project in 3D particular properties. Main micro-CT applications are porosity measurements and visualizations. The paper shows first results of measurements and imaging of rock porous space, using micro-CT method.en
